The name Kanjeevaram or kanjivaram saree comes from a small town or village named Kanchipuram in the Indian state of Tamil Nadu, where these sarees are believed to have originated from.
The saree or any outfit made in this woven fabric is considered a perfect ensemble for all kinds of important events, festivities, and different types of occasions like weddings, sangeet, haldi, and all. The classic weave produces a material that is thick and is tinged with silver or gold borders and motifs across the saree body. Kanchipuram saree is also a popular choice of the bridal ensemble in most parts of Southern India.

 

While many of us just pick up a saree we like, there are actually many different types of Kanchipuram or kanjivaram silk sarees you can choose from, depending on the upcoming occasions you are planning to attend this season:

1. Plain Kanjeevaram saree with gold border - This one might sound simple and elegant but the border is golden giving it a rich look. Perfect for your friend’s upcoming engagement or wedding ceremony!

2. Temple Border Kanjivaram saree – The name suggests a zigzag temple border with a chevron styled peaks’ design known as a temple, which makes it stand out from other types of kanjivaram sarees. Perfect for your anniversary party – even your own!

3. Modern Kanjeevaram weaves saree – These are woven in newer colors and contemporary designs and motifs on beautiful borders, definitely the first choice for the new-age bride!

4. Traditional Kanjeevaram saree – The coin, chakra, or checked motifs are the symbolically traditional kanjivaram sarees, and these surely are the richest weaves among others. This is a perfect wedding, festival, pooja, or bridal wear saree a gorgeous drape evergreen for every age.

 

How to maintain your Kanjivaram saree:

1. Always dry clean your beautiful saree silk is a delicate fabric and therefore it needs a skilled hand to wash it and dry cleaning is the best way to handle your fabric.

2. If you do end up washing your kanjivaram saree at home, always use cold water and just a little shampoo only after the first three washes. Harsh detergents and brushes will be very harmful to your beloved saree! 

3. Wash the sari, the pallu, and the border of your sari separately to avoid damage to your gorgeous saree.

4. Never wring your saree that would be the last thing you want to do. It will wrinkle your kanjeevaram saree and spoil it forever. First, you have to roll your saree in a dry towel to remove the excess moisture and then, hang.

5. You should always avoid drying your kanjivaram silk saree in direct sunlight you should dry it on the inside of your home where there is no direct harsh sunlight on it.

6. Never ever iron your saree directly, always put a cloth on it and iron. Direct iron will affect the beautiful shine of the saree.
